For instance, a company looking to utilize Microsoft Windows Server would acquire a Microsoft Windows Server license in order to install and run the Windows Server software on the physical server itself. CALs are used in conjunction with Microsoft Server software licenses to allow Users and Devices to access and utilize the services of that server software. With Software Assurance: Microsoft License Mobility through Software Assurance allows many Microsoft software licenses to be brought into the AWS Cloud for use with Amazon EC2.Īmazon EC2 offers Dedicated Hosts, which allow you to access hardware that's fully dedicated for your use. For more information on bringing licenses without Software Assurance or License Mobility benefits, please visit this section of the FAQ. This makes it possible to bring Microsoft software licenses that do not have Software Assurance or License Mobility benefits as long as the licenses are purchased prior to Octoor added as a true-up under an active Enterprise Enrollment that was effective prior to October 1, 2019. Without Software Assurance: Using Amazon EC2 Dedicated Hosts, you can access hardware fully dedicated for your use.
